Hello all, i'm about to give up with this Mosquito it just won't take off. I have tried all the suggestions in the tutorials flaps down/up, 1/2 notch trim nose down or 2 notches trim nose down control stick fully back or in the neutral position , i can keep it (relatively) straight down the runway but it wont accelerate past 110 knots or lift the tail wheel so i end up either ploughing into the runway lights and exploding or trying in vain to lift off and stalling and exploding. I have the DCS P51 and Spitfire and have no problems with those. Any help/ideas greatly appreciated. Thanks. (Using X56 HOTAS)
